[188 Pages Report] The Beneficial Insects Market size was estimated at USD 946.84 million in 2023 and expected to reach USD 1,029.69 million in 2024, at a CAGR 9.18% to reach USD 1,751.90 million by 2030.

Beneficial insects provide natural pest control solutions and pollination services for agricultural crops and green spaces. These insects are considered environmentally friendly alternatives to chemical pesticides, contributing to sustainable agriculture and maintaining ecological balance. The demand for organic food is rising due to increasing health awareness among consumers, resulting in adopting of eco-friendly methods, including beneficial insects in crop production that reduce synthetic pesticides. Governmental support through policies and subsidies promoting integrated pest management (IPM) strategies contributes significantly to the adoption of beneficial insects. However, the lack of awareness among farmers about biological pest control methods may lead to slow adoption rates of beneficial insects. Moreover, research advancements in understanding insect biology have led to the development of more effective applications of these organisms in pest management systems.

Type: Expanding applications of predators in sustainable agriculture practices

Parasitoids are the type of beneficial insects that lay their eggs on or inside the bodies of arthropods, ultimately causing the host's death as the parasitoid larvae develop and consume its tissues. These insects are crucial in controlling pest populations, contributing to sustainable agricultural practices. Parasitoids are essential for farmers seeking natural pest control solutions that do not rely on chemicals. Pollinators are beneficial insects essential for maintaining healthy ecosystems and ensuring food security through pollination services provided to various crops. The need-based preference for pollinator species is driven primarily by their ability to increase crop yields while promoting biodiversity within agricultural systems. Predatory insects play a vital role in maintaining ecological balance by preying on various pests and preventing their populations from reaching harmful levels. The need-based preference for predators depends on their ability to effectively manage agricultural pests while minimizing harm to non-target organisms or natural ecosystems. Comparative analysis indicates that predators often have broader prey ranges compared to parasitoids, making them more versatile in controlling multiple pest species simultaneously.

Crop Type: Significant use for cultivation of fruits & vegetables

The flowers and ornamentals rely on beneficial insects to reduce pesticide usage and promote sustainable pest management practices. Predatory mites such as Amblyseius swirskii and Aphidoletes aphidimyza are prevalent for controlling pests, including thrips, whiteflies, aphids, and spider mites. Fruit and vegetable growers also benefit from the use of beneficial insects as they help maintain a balance between pests and natural predators within these agroecosystems. Beneficial insects used in fruit and vegetable crops are ladybugs, lacewings, Trichogramma wasps, and predatory mites. Grain and pulse growers use beneficial insects to bolster their integrated pest management strategies and reduce chemical inputs.

Application: Proliferating demand of beneficial insects for crop protection

In crop production, beneficial insects play a significant role in enhancing healthy plant growth and improving yields. These insects are essential for pollination, directly impacting fruit and seed production. Another major contributor to crop production is soil-dwelling beneficial insects, including predatory mites and nematodes that help control pests by feeding on their eggs or larvae. Crop protection focuses on managing pests and diseases that negatively affect plant health and reduce yields. Beneficial insects serve as natural biological control agents in this process by preying on harmful pests, reducing the reliance on chemical pesticides. The primary difference between crop production and crop protection is their objectives: promoting plant growth through pollination versus safeguarding plants from harmful pests or diseases.

The Revolution of Mass Production of Beneficial Insects: A Game-Changer for the Scope of Agriculture
Beneficial insects serve as valuable assets in agriculture as they play a significant role in pest control and pollination. Their contribution to the ecosystem is vital in promoting a sustainable environment. Scientists have been exploring ways to improve the mass production of beneficial insects, and the results have been revolutionary. The advancement in technology in this field has presented farmers with new opportunities to integrate beneficial insects into their agriculture practices. Here, we discuss the benefits of high volume production of these insects and the impact it has on the scope of agriculture.

Enhancement of Pest Control:

Insects such as parasitoid wasps, ladybugs, and lacewings are popular, beneficial insects that control pests indirectly. They are predators that prey on harmful insects and regulate their numbers. With the increased production of beneficial insects, technologies such as automated rearing units have made it possible to scale-up agriculture practices at a lower cost while increasing efficiency. The precision with which beneficial insects can be released on crops helps in directly addressing pest problems. Mass production helps address issues of pesticide resistance and further reduces the risk of chemicals entering the food chain.

Increased Crop Yields:

Introducing beneficial insects to farms results in significantly increased crop yields. The use of beneficial insects reduces the reliance on chemical control of harmful insects. Beneficial insects are intelligent and can locate specific plants in search of prey. These insects protect crops from pests and facilitate the pollination process, resulting in increased yield, higher quality crops, and improved farm profitability. The use of beneficial insects is particularly beneficial in organic farming practices, which rely heavily on nature to continue agricultural production.

Reduced Environmental Impact:

Conventional agriculture practices contribute to environmental pollution as they rely heavily on chemical pesticides. The widespread use of pesticides poses a significant threat to the environment by contaminating the soil, water, and air. The overuse of pesticides has resulted in the development of resistance among pests and increased the use of stronger pesticides, further damaging the environment. The use of beneficial insects is eco-friendly and sustainable, as they reduce the need for chemical pesticides, resulting in a better and healthier environment.

Increased Profits:

The use of beneficial insects in pest control has proven to be economically sustainable. The innovation in mass production practices has made the production of beneficial insects affordable and efficient. The cost of mass production is lower compared to the use of conventional pesticides as essential equipment, such as automated rearing units, are durable and have a reduced maintenance cost. The introduction of beneficial insects also results in higher crop yields, hence increased profitability for farmers.

The integration of beneficial insects in agriculture practices is a significant step towards promoting sustainable and ecologically sound practices. The mass production of beneficial insects is an innovative solution that is cost-effective, efficient, and environmentally sustainable. The technology used in mass production has revolutionized the agriculture industry by providing farmers with a natural approach to pest control that is profitable and yields a positive outcome. As we continue to explore ways to make agriculture sustainable, introducing the use of beneficial insects in farming practices is a step toward achieving a better tomorrow.
